    // hexDecode decodes a short hex digit sequence: "10" -> 16.
    func hexDecode(s []byte) rune {
    	n := '\x00'
    	for _, c := range s {
    		n <<= 4
    		switch {
    		case '0' <= c && c <= '9':
    			n |= rune(c - '0')
    		case 'a' <= c && c <= 'f':
    			n |= rune(c-'a') + 10
    		case 'A' <= c && c <= 'F':
    			n |= rune(c-'A') + 10
    		default:
    			panic(fmt.Sprintf("Bad hex digit in %q", s))
    		}
    	}
    	return n

    func lower(ch rune) rune     { return ('a' - 'A') | ch } // returns lower-case ch iff ch is ASCII letter
    func isLetter(ch rune) bool  { return 'a' <= lower(ch) && lower(ch) <= 'z' || ch == '_' }
    func isDecimal(ch rune) bool { return '0' <= ch && ch <= '9' }
    func isHex(ch rune) bool     { return '0' <= ch && ch <= '9' || 'a' <= lower(ch) && lower(ch) <= 'f' }

    func digitVal(ch rune) int {
    	switch {
    	case '0' <= ch && ch <= '9':
    		return int(ch - '0')
    	case 'a' <= lower(ch) && lower(ch) <= 'f':
    		return int(lower(ch) - 'a' + 10)
    	}
    	return 16 // larger than any legal digit val
    }
    
    func lower(ch rune) rune     { return ('a' - 'A') | ch } // returns lower-case ch iff ch is ASCII letter
    func isDecimal(ch rune) bool { return '0' <= ch && ch <= '9' }
